[edit] Biography
Dick Chorovich (Richard Milan Chorovich) was born on November 29, 1933 in St. Clairsville, Ohio. After going to high school at St. Clairsville (OH), Chorovich attended Miami University of Ohio. Chorovich made his professional debut in the NFL in 1955 with the Baltimore Colts. He played in the NFL for 2 years, playing for the Baltimore Colts the entire time. Chorovich also played in the AFL for 1 year, playing for the Los Angeles Chargers the entire time.
